Rules & Regulations
No building, fence, wall or other structure shall be commenced, erected or maintained upon the Properties, nor shall any exterior addition to or change, including paint and trim, roofing, or alteration therein be made until the plans and specifications showing the nature, kind, shape, height, materials, color of paint, color of roofing, and location of the same shall have been submitted to and approved in writing as to harmony of external design and location in relation to surrounding structures and topography by the Architectural
Control Committee. In the event said Board, or its designated committee, fails to approve or disapprove such design and location within thirty (30) days after said plans
and specifications have been submitted to it, approval will not be required and this Article will be deemed to have been fully complied with.
The Association shall be responsible for the removal of Lot Owner’s trash. The Lot Owner shall place his/her trash in the designated area in the subdivision for removal by the Association. No trash, garbage or other refuse shall be burned upon any Lot except within the interior of the residence, except that the builder or developer may burn debris for the purpose of cleaning the land or preparing any dwelling for occupancy.
The Association shall be responsible for snow removal from the joint parking easement areas shown on the plat recorded herewith and abutting sidewalks. Snow removal from the Lots and Lot Owners’ sidewalks and driveway shall be the responsibility of the Lot Owner. Each Owner shall be responsible for cutting all grass, weed removal, mulching, plant, and shrub maintenance for their respective properties.
With the exception of any hedge planted by the Declarant, no hedge shall be planted or permitted to grow over three and one-half (3Vs) feet high along the property line, nor shall any growth be permitted by an Owner or tenant to extend beyond his property line.
No animals, livestock or poultry of any kind shall be raised, bred or kept on any Lot, except that dogs, cats or other usual household pets may be kept, provided that they are not kept, bred, or maintained for commercial or charitable purposes or in unusual numbers.
No exterior clothesline or hanging devise shall be allowed upon any Lot, and no antenna shall project above the surface of the roof. A satellite dish, not in excess of twenty-four (24) inches in diameter, may be installed upon the Lots provided that said satellite dish does not extend beyond the roof-line of the dwelling to which it is attached. The installation of any satellite dish is subject to the approval of the Architectural Control Committee.
No sign of any kind shall be displayed on any Lot, except one (1) sign of not more than five (5)square feet advertising the property for sale or rent, except signs used by the developer and its agents to advertise the property during the construction and sales period.
No noxious or offensive use of activity shall be carried on upon any Lot or parking area, nor shall any practice be engaged in by the Owners of the Lots, their tenants, agents, guests, or assigns, that shall become an annoyance or a nuisance t0 the neighborhood.
No utility, boat, house camper, etc. recreational vehicle, trailer, bus, commercial equipment, disabled or unlicensed vehicle or material portion thereof, or commercial vehicle larger than three-fourths (3/4) ton, may be parked on any street or parking area, or Lot within said land area, unless, in the case of commercial equipments, it shall be temporarily within such subdivision for the purpose of performing work therein.
No building, freestanding garage, trailer, tent, or other structure may be erected, built, or permitted to remain on any Lot other than one (1) townhouse dwelling not to exceed three (3) stories in height.
No Lot shall be used, except for residential purposes, or for builders’ construction sheds and sales and administrative offices during the construction and sales period, and not more than one (1) principal building shall be permitted on any residential Lot shown on said plat, and no such Lot shall be resubdivided so as to produce a building site of less area or width than the minimum required by the Subdivision Ordinance of the County.
